How many oils are mentioned in the Bible?

At least 33 different essential oils or aromatic oil-producing plants are mentioned in the Bible (12 of them are discussed in this Appendix plus cinnamon and calamus.) The word “oil” is mentioned 191 times in the Bible.

What oil did Jesus feet use?

Martha served, while Lazarus was among those reclining at the table with him. Then Mary took about a pint of pure nard, an expensive perfume; she poured it on Jesus’ feet and wiped his feet with her hair.

What oils did Esther use in the Bible?

In preparation to see the King, Esther went through a purification using oil of myrrh for six months and sweet odours for six months. The sweet fragrance of Queen Esther and Myrrh represent our need to purify our hearts to become the Bride the Lord finds favor with when He returns.

What is myrrh oil?

Myrrh is a natural, aromatic, sap-like resin or “gum” that is derived from the small, thorny Commiphora myrrha tree, which is related to the Frankincense tree. In aromatherapy, Myrrh Essential Oil is known to offer relief for colds, congestion, coughs, bronchitis, and phlegm.

What is frankincense used for in the Bible?

Frankincense is the gum or resin of the Boswellia tree, used for making perfume and incense. It was one of the ingredients God instructed the Israelites to use in making the pure and sacred incense blend for the most holy place in the tabernacle.

What is God’s healing oil?

Myrrh is the oil first mentioned in the Bible, but it is also the last. It is mentioned in the books of Genesis and Revelation. Also, Myrrh is the first oil mentioned in the life of Jesus and also the last- it was used to anoint Him before His death.

What is the oil of God?

Oil represents this presence and power of the Spirit of God throughout the Bible. Jesus was often referred to as the Anointed One, using oil as a metaphor for the Holy Spirit being present and acting in Christ.
